Emma bought a pair of earrings, a dress and a coat. The dress cost 6 times as much as the earrings, and the coat cost 13 times a
mote1985 [20]

Answer:cost of earring=$160

cost of dress=  $960

cost of coat =$2,080

Step-by-step explanation:

Let cost of earring be represented as x

so that the cost of dress =6x

And the cost of coat =13x

Since the  three items cost a total of $3200, we can develop an equation which can be represented as

cost of earring+cost of dress +cost of coat =3200

x +6x+13x=3200

20x =3200

x=3200/20=160

THerefore cost of earring=$160

cost of dress=  6x =$160 x 6=$960

cost of coat = 13x = $160 x 13=$2,080

An object is launched into the air. The projectile motion of the object can be modeled using the function h(t) = –16t2 + 72t + 5
vladimir2022 [97]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

In the equation, 72t represents the initial upwards velocity and 5 represents the initial launching height.  The leading term represents the pull of gravity on the object in the English system of measurement.

So the first question says the initial height is 5 feet.  TRUE

The second question says the initial vertical velocity is -72.  FALSE (it's positive 72 ft/sec)

The third question says that the object will hit the ground after approximately 4.57 seconds.  TRUE.  Find this by setting the h(t) on the left equal to 0, since this is the height at any time during the flight.  When h(t) = 0, that means that there is NO height, which means the object is on the ground.  Set the equation equal to 0 and factor to find t.  Putting that into the quadratic formula gives you t values of -.068 and 4.57.  Since the 2 things in math that will NEVER EVER be negative are distances and time, we can safely disregard the negative t value and go with t = 4.57.

The fourth question says that after t = 3 seconds, the object is 173 feet high.  FALSE.  Find this by subbing in a 3 for every t in the equation.

h(3)=-16(3)^2+72(3)+5

This gives you that h(3) = 77 feet

The last question says that at t = 0, h(t) = 0.  FALSE again.  Sub in a 0 for every t in the equation, and you get h(0) = 5, which is the initial launching height.
